Nubia Z40 Pro and RedMagic 7 Performance
In the upcoming Snapdragon 8 Gen1 powered phones list, besides the Redmi K50 Gaming Edition, ZTE is about to release three flagship series namely Nubia Z40 Series, RedMagic 7 Series, and Axon 40 Series.
In today’s morning, WHYLAB revealed that Nubia Z40 Pro (NX701J) and ZTE Axon 40 (ZTE A2023BH), two Snapdragon 8 Gen1 flagships, have already passed the radio approval of the State Ministry of Industry and Information Technology, which means they will be released soon.


According to the previous news, Nubia Z40 Pro will be equipped with the first aerospace-grade heat dissipation of new materials, called “master of the dragon”, with a strong heat dissipation system, running the large game can also ensure that the body is not hot.
Officials have revealed that the Nubia Z40 Pro will use the industry’s only custom 35mm main camera, the world’s first joint custom Sony IMX787, which can bring SLR-level optical bokeh, f/1.6 large aperture, support OIS optical stabilization, full pixel focus, redefining cell phone images.
Recently, Nubia model NX701J appeared on the Geekbench benchmark test platform, equipped with 16GB running memory, single-core run score 1200 points, multi-core 3489 points.

As for the RedMagic 7 performance, the official shared a benchmarking video through Weibo. In the test video, RedMagic said that RedMagic 7 AnTuTu benchmark score reached 1101769 points.
Through the video, it is understood that the RedMagic 7 series has LPDDR5 + UFS 3.1, Arc performance enhancement system: MAGIC WRITE fast read and write, RAM BOOST memory acceleration, MAGIC GPU image enhancement, etc.
